
* {
font-family: Verdana, Tahoma,  Arial, Helvetica, sans-serif;
font-size: 11px;  
}

body {
background: #EAEAEA;
margin: 0;
padding: 0;
}

a img {
border: 0;
}

div#main {
margin: 0 auto 0;
padding: 0;
width: 987px;
}

/* S: Top*/
div#top {
background: url(/images/top.jpg) no-repeat;
width: 987px;
height: 183px;
border-bottom: 3px solid #0A9603;
float: left;
}

#logo {
width: 213px;
float: left;
}

#logo a {
position: relative;
top: 118px;
left: 37px;
width: 213px;
height: 33px;
cursor: pointer;
display: block;
}

#logo a span {
display: none;
}

/* S: Lang */
#lang {
background: url(/images/bg_lang.gif) no-repeat;
width: 149px;
height: 24px;
float: right;
position: relative;
right: 10px;
margin: 0;
padding: 2px 0 0 0;
color: #FFF;
text-align: center;
}

#lang a {
margin: 0;
padding: 6px;
color: #FFF;
text-decoration: none;
}

#lang a:hover {
text-decoration: underline;
}

#lang a#active {
text-decoration: underline;
}
/* B: Lang */

/* S: Calendar */
div#tab_calendar {
float: right; 
margin: 0;
padding: 0;
height: 183px;
width: 218px;
}

table#calendar {
margin: 0;
padding: 0;
}

table#calendar td.cal {
height: 25px;
width: 26px;
border-bottom: 1px solid #7C7C7C; 
vertical-align: middle;
text-align: center;
}

table#calendar td.cal_1 {
height: 25px;
width: 26px;
border-bottom: 1px solid #7C7C7C; 
vertical-align: middle;
text-align: center;
color: #838383;
}

table#calendar td.cal_red {
height: 25px;
width: 26px;
border-bottom: 1px solid #7C7C7C; 
vertical-align: middle;
text-align: center;
color: #EB0101;
}

table#calendar td.cal_title {
height: 26px;
border-bottom: 1px solid #7C7C7C; 
vertical-align: middle;
}

table#calendar td.cal_back {
border-bottom: 1px solid #7C7C7C; 
text-align: right;
vertical-align: middle;
}

table#calendar td.cal_forward {
border-bottom: 1px solid #7C7C7C; 
text-align: left;
vertical-align: middle;
}

table#calendar td.active {
background: url(/images/cal_active.gif) center no-repeat;
width: 26px;
height: 24px;
border-bottom: 1px solid #7C7C7C; 
text-align: center;
vertical-align: middle;
color: #FFF;
}

table#calendar td.active a {
padding: 3px;
color: #FFF;
text-decoration: none; 
}
/* B: Calendar */
/* B: Top */

/* S: Apaksheejaa dalja */
div#bottombg {
background: #FFF;
margin: 0;
padding: 0;
}

div#bottom {
background: #FFF url(/images/bottom.jpg) bottom no-repeat;
width: 987px;
float: left;
}

/* S: Left_menu */
div#left {
background: #F4F4F4 url(/images/left_bottom.gif) bottom no-repeat;
width: 192px;
margin: 0 0 100px 0;
padding: 0 0 30px 0;
border-right: 1px solid #DADADA;
float: left;
}

div#menu {
background: url(/images/bg_left.gif) top right no-repeat;
width: 172px;
margin: 0;
padding: 0 10px;
float: left;
}

#menu ul {
padding: 0;
margin: 15px 0 0 0;
}

#menu ul li {
margin: 0;
padding: 0;
list-style-type: none;
border-bottom: 1px solid #AAA;
}

#menu ul li a {
padding: 4px 20px 3px 10px;
margin: 0;
display: block;
height: 16px;
color: #000;
text-decoration: none;
}

html>body #menu ul li a {
height: auto;
min-height: 16px;
}

#menu ul li a:hover {
text-decoration: underline;
}

#menu ul li a#active {
background: url(/images/menu_active.gif) right repeat-y;
color: #FFF;
}

#menu ul li ul {
margin: 0;
}

#menu ul li ul li {
border-top: 1px solid #AAA;
border-bottom: 0;
}

#menu ul li ul li a {
padding-left: 20px;
}

#menu ul li ul li ul li a {
padding-left: 30px;
}
/* B: Left_menu */

/* S: Content */
div#content {
position: relative;
width: 527px;
margin: 0;
padding: 20px 10px 53px 20px;
text-align: justify;
float: left;
}

div.content_text {
margin: 0;
padding: 0;
}

#content p {
margin: 0;
padding: 5px 0;
}

#content h1 {
margin: 0;
padding: 0 8px;
border-bottom: 2px solid #56A61B;
font-size: 13px;
float: left;
}

div#content h2 {
margin: 0 0 4px 0;
padding: 0;
}

div#content h3 {
margin: 0 0 4px 0;
padding: 0;
color: #427A17;
}

#content a {
color: #427A17;
}

#content a:hover {
color: #757575;
}

#content img.foto {
border: 1px solid #000;
margin: 0 10px 10px 0;
}

#content .line {
clear: left;
width: 100%;
height: 10px;
border-top: 1px solid #9C9C9C;
margin: 0;
padding: 0;
}

/* B: Content */

/* S: Right */
div#right {
width: 228px;
margin: 0;
padding: 0;
float: right;
}

div#search {
background: #F4F4F4 url(/images/bg_search.gif) no-repeat;
width: 218px;
margin: 0;
padding: 6px 0;
border-left: 1px solid #DADADA;
border-bottom: 6px solid #DADADA;
float: right;
}

#search h1 {
margin: 12px 0 0 18px;
padding: 0;
}

.form_ {
margin: 0;
padding: 0;
width: 203px;
}

#form_box {
margin: 8px 0 7px 0;
border: 1px solid #A7A7A7;
width: 186px;
height: 17px;
float: right;
}

.form_box1 {
margin: 1px 0 1px 10px;
border: 1px solid #A7A7A7;
width: 186px;
height: 17px;
}

.form_box2 {
margin: 1px 0 1px 10px;
border: 1px solid #A7A7A7;
width: 186px;
height: 80px;
}

#form_meklet {
float: right;
}

div#menu_right {
background: url(/images/menu_right.gif) no-repeat;
width: 228px;
margin: 15px 0;
padding: 0;
float: right;
}

div#login_form {
width: 228px;
margin: 15px 0;
padding: 0;
float: right;
}

#menu_right ul {
padding: 0;
margin: 0 0 0 9px;
}

#menu_right ul li {
margin: 0;
padding: 0;
list-style-type: none;
line-height: 35px;
font-weight: bold;
}

#menu_right ul li a {
padding: 0 0 0 12px;
margin: 0;
height: 35px;
display: block;
color: #FFF;
font-size: 12px;
text-decoration: none;
}

/* S: sezu_lemumi */
ul li a#sezu_lemumi {
background: url(/images/sezu_lemumi.gif) no-repeat;
}

ul li a:hover#sezu_lemumi {
background: url(/images/sezu_lemumi_a.gif) no-repeat;
}

ul li a#sezu_lemumi_active {
background: url(/images/sezu_lemumi_a.gif) no-repeat;
}
/* B: sezu_lemumi */

/* S: uzdot_jautajumu */
ul li a#uzdot_jautajumu {
background: url(/images/uzdot_jautajumu.gif) no-repeat;
}

ul li a:hover#uzdot_jautajumu {
background: url(/images/uzdot_jautajumu_a.gif) no-repeat;
}

ul li a#uzdot_jautajumu_active {
background: url(/images/uzdot_jautajumu_a.gif) no-repeat;
}
/* B: uzdot_jautajumu */

/* S: forums */
ul li a#forums {
background: url(/images/forums.gif) no-repeat;
}

ul li a:hover#forums {
background: url(/images/forums_a.gif) no-repeat;
}

ul li a#forums_active {
background: url(/images/forums_a.gif) no-repeat;
}
/* B: forums */

/* S: fotogalerija */
ul li a#fotogalerija {
background: url(/images/fotogalerija.gif) no-repeat;
}

ul li a:hover#fotogalerija {
background: url(/images/fotogalerija_a.gif) no-repeat;
}

ul li a#fotogalerija_active {
background: url(/images/fotogalerija_a.gif) no-repeat;
}
/* B: fotogalerija */

/* S: veidlapas */
ul li a#veidlapas {
background: url(/images/veidlapas.gif) no-repeat;
}

ul li a:hover#veidlapas {
background: url(/images/veidlapas_a.gif) no-repeat;
}

ul li a#veidlapas_active {
background: url(/images/veidlapas_a.gif) no-repeat;
}
/* B: veidlapas */

/* S: iepirkumi */
ul li a#iepirkumi {
background: url(/images/iepirkumi.gif) no-repeat;
}

ul li a:hover#iepirkumi {
background: url(/images/iepirkumi_a.gif) no-repeat;
}

ul li a#iepirkumi_active {
background: url(/images/iepirkumi_a.gif) no-repeat;
}
/* B: iepirkumi */
/* B: Right */

/* S: Datateks */
#datateks { 
clear: both;
padding: 0 0 0 864px;
margin-bottom: 2px;
}

#datateks a {
display: block;
width: 45px;
height: 38px;
}
#datateks a#host { 
height: 15px;
}

#datateks a span { 
display: none;
}
/* B: Datateks */
/* B: Apaksheejaa dalja */

/* S: Text_bottom */
div#textbottom {
/* position: relative; */
clear: both;
background: #FFF;
width: 987px;
float: left;
}

#textbottom p {
margin: 0;
padding: 20px 0;
text-align: center;
color: #757575;
}

#textbottom a {
text-decoration: underline;
color: #757575;
}
/* B: Text_bottom */

/* S: Sezu lemumi */
#content .line_1 {
margin: 0;
padding: 0;
border-bottom: 1px solid #9C9C9C;
width: 100%;
}

#content .line_2 {
background: #F7F7F7;
margin: 0;
padding: 0;
border-top: 1px solid #F2F2F2;
border-bottom: 1px solid #9C9C9C;
width: 100%;
}

div.content_text {
margin: 10px;
}

div.icon_left {
float: left;
}

.lemumi {
margin: 0 0 0 30px;
}

div.date {
padding: 0 0 5px 0;
color: #757575;
}
/* B: Sezu lemumi */

/* S: Forums */
#content .comment {
padding-bottom: 5px;
color: #6D3421;
}

#content .comment a {
color: #6D3421;
}

div.forum_date {
margin: 0;
padding: 0 15px 0 0;
color: #757575;
float: left;
}

div.forum_date1 {
padding-bottom: 5px;
color: #757575;
}

.more {
margin: 0 0 15px 0;
padding: 0;
}

.more a {
display: inline;
background: url(/images/more.gif) right 4px no-repeat;
margin: 0;
padding: 0 12px 0 0;
}

.form_send {background: url(/images/bg_botton.gif) repeat-x;height: 19px;border: 0px solid #429406;color: #FFF;font-weight: bold;vertical-align: middle;margin: 0;padding: 1px 8px 3px 8px;}
/* B: Forums */

/* S: Fotogalerija */
.gallery {
margin-bottom: 10px;
width: 100%;
float: left;
}

.gallery a img {
border: 1px solid #9C9C9C;
}

/* Visas Galerijas */
ul.galAll {
list-style: none;
margin: 0;
padding: 0;
}

ul.galAll li {
margin: 0;
padding: 10px 0;
clear: left;
}

ul.galAll li a img {
float: left;
width: 150px;
margin-right: 10px;
}

ul.galAll li a {
text-decoration: none;
}

span.galAllName {
color: #757575;
}

span.galAllName a {
font-weight: bold;
}

/* Viena galerija */
div.galOne {
padding: 10px 11px;
float: left;
}

.galOne a img {
width: 150px;
}

.galBack {
margin: 8px 0;
padding: 0;
clear: both;
}

.galBack a {
display: inline;
background: url(/images/back.gif) left 2px no-repeat;
margin: 0;
padding: 0 0 0 12px;
text-decoration: none;
color: #4773A0;
font-weight: bold;
}


.galerija_back {
padding: 5px 15px;
text-align: left;
}

.galerija_back a {
color: #777;
text-decoration: none;
}

.galerija_back a:hover {
text-decoration: underline;
}

.galerija_forward {
padding: 5px 15px;
text-align: right;
}

.galerija_forward a {
color: #777;
text-decoration: none;
}

.galerija_forward a:hover {
text-decoration: underline;
}

.gal_forward {
margin: 0;
padding: 0;
}

.gal_forward a {
display: inline;
background: url(/images/more.gif) right 5px no-repeat;
margin: 0;
padding: 0 10px 0 0;
}

.gal_back {
margin: 0;
padding: 0;
}

.gal_back a {
display: inline;
background: url(/images/back.gif) left 5px no-repeat;
margin: 0;
padding: 0 0 0 10px;
}

.gallery img.big_img {
border: 1px solid #9C9C9C;
width: 400px;
}
/* B: Fotogalerija */

/* S: Iepirkumi */
span.icon {
padding-left: 30px;
}
/* B: Iepirkumi */


table.wordTable {
border-top: 1px solid #9C9C9C;
border-right: 1px solid #9C9C9C;
}

table.wordTable td {
border-bottom: 1px solid #9C9C9C;
border-left: 1px solid #9C9C9C;
}

div.content_actual {margin: 10px;padding: 0;}
.content_actual h2 {margin: 0;padding: 0;}
.content_actual span.date {padding-left: 0; padding-right: 10px; color: #757575;}


